Reader: no iLife/Keynote offers for Canada

updated 01:10 pm EST, Sat February 15, 2003


MacNN reader Terry Garbutt writes ". You can contact it at 1-800-800-2775. However that phone number is listed anywhere on the Canadian site. More to the point Apple Canada has chosen once again to lag not follow. There is no iLife/Keynote offering to the Canadian educator. The Apple Canada representative I spoke to on the 13th Feb. indicated Apple Canada was waiting to see the "reaction" the offer had in the US. They would be happy to list my "interest" and, no, I was the only one expressing this 'interest'. Another example of Apple Canada's second class treatment on Canada."
